SOUTH PHILADELPHIA -- A man in his 70s is dead after he was struck by a car in South Philadelphia.

It happened around 8:00 p.m. in the area of 23rd Street and West Oregon Avenue.

The victim was struck by a 2004 Ford Explorer that was travelling westbound.

He was taken to Jefferson Hospital where he was pronounced dead.

The driver of the striking vehicle did stop at the scene.

The accident is under investigation.
